The Urban Freight Lab at the University of Washington is a living laboratory composed of academic researchers, public-sector agencies, and interconnected private-sector companies in transportation and logistics — retailers, carriers and shippers, infrastructure and operational technology providers, real estate, and vehicle and vehicle part manufacturers. Behind every Little Free Pantry is a network of people helping one another. In a recent KUOW Public Radio-OPB interview, Urban Freight Lab Senior Research Scientist Giacomo Dalla Chiara discusses PantryMap and what researchers are learning about Seattle’s network of community pantries, from food donations and pantry activity to the broader role these spaces play in supporting neighbors across the region. It's a thoughtful conversation about food access, mutual aid, and the value of making these community resources more visible.

We are thrilled to celebrate two of our Ph.D. students, Travis Fried, Ph.D. and Tom Maxner, Ph.D., on completing their doctoral degrees.

Both Travis and Tom have been integral to the Urban Freight Lab community, making meaningful contributions to our research program, advancing work in urban freight systems, helping shape how cities can move goods more efficiently and equitably, and serving on our UW Sustainable Transportation - Planning & Livable Communities Master's Degree and Supply Chain Transportation & Logistics Graduate Degree teaching teams.

We are especially excited that they will both be continuing their work here with the UFL. Travis has stepped into a Research Engineer role, and Tom into the role of Director of the Lab.

We're so grateful for their scholarship, collaboration, and leadership, and look forward to what they will build in these next chapters.
